What is the Corpus Juris Civilis? Why Should You Care?

Alright, let's rewind a bit. What exactly is the Corpus Juris Civilis? Think of it as the ultimate legal rulebook compiled during the reign of the Byzantine Emperor Justinian I in the 6th century AD. It's not just a single document; it's a massive collection of laws, legal writings, and commentaries that aimed to codify and systematize Roman law. This collection became the foundation of civil law systems in Europe and beyond, influencing legal thinking and practice for over a thousand years. Its importance cannot be overstated; it's the bedrock upon which many modern legal systems are built.

Diving into the Components of the Corpus Juris Civilis

The Corpus Juris Civilis is not a single book but rather a collection of four main parts: the Codex, the Digest or Pandects, the Institutes, and the Novellae. Each part plays a unique role in the legal system:

  • The Codex: This is a collection of imperial constitutions (laws) issued by Roman emperors. It was a crucial part of Justinian's legal reforms, streamlining and clarifying existing laws.
  • The Digest or Pandects: This is a compilation of excerpts from the writings of Roman jurists (legal scholars). It covers various legal topics and provides interpretations and analyses of Roman law. This is where you get deep into the legal thought of the time.
  • The Institutes: This is an introductory textbook for law students, providing a basic overview of Roman law. It served as a primer to help understand the more complex legal concepts.
  • The Novellae: These are new laws and constitutions issued by Emperor Justinian after the Codex. They reflect the evolution of legal thought during his reign.
